Chinese Doctors to Conduct 500 Free Eye Surgeries in Pakistan Next Month

A crew of Chinese doctors will perform 500 eye surgeries on poor and needy people at the Pakistan Eye Bank Society Hospital North Karachi next year from January 10th to the 24th stated Dr. Qaiser Sajjad, Pakistan Medical Association secretary general, in a press conference at PMA House Karachi,


We feel happy to inform the people about the ‘Bright Journey Pakistan’ project, wherein 500 eye surgeries will be performed by the Chinese ophthalmologists at the PEBS Hospital, a charity facility, in North Karachi from January 10-24.


A contingent encompassing of officials from the Chinese Embassy and Chinese Consulate in Karachi visited PEBS Hospital to check in with the arrangements and available facilities as well as to discuss the protocols and standard operating procedures for the upcoming eye camp.

It is being carried out as a gesture of goodwill to promote friendly relations between the two countries,” says Dr. Shoukat Malik, the president of PMA Karachi.

A memorandum of understanding was signed by the four-member Chinese delegation, which was headed by Hu Meiqi, deputy director of International Health Exchange and Cooperation, China (IHECC). He said that IHECC would bear all expenses related to eye surgeries and would be organizing as a peace offering from China to the poor and needy people of Pakistan.

It is hoped that similar activities will follow in other fields of medicine across Pakistan says Dr. Wasiq.

It will be an excellent opportunity to share knowledge and skills among doctors of the two countries in the field of ophthalmology,” said Hu Meiqi.

Dr. Qaiser Sajjad also believes that this step would strengthen the ties and boost Pak-China friendship among the people.
